元数据管理与CWM标准解析课件.ppt
《元数据管理与CWM标准解析课件.ppt》由会员分享,可在线阅读,更多相关《元数据管理与CWM标准解析课件.ppt(86页珍藏版)》请在三一办公上搜索。
1、元数据管理与CWM标准,中国移动业务支撑系统部2008-04,提纲,元数据管理基本概念元数据定义元数据管理CWM元数据标准CWM标准概述对象模型层基础层资源层分析层管理层,元数据定义,“关于数据的数据”比一般意义的数据范畴更加广泛不仅表示数据的类型、名称、值等信息提供数据的上下文描述信息(比如数据的所属区域、取值范围、数据间的关系、业务规则、数据来源等等),元数据定义,经营分析系统关心的元数据,业务元数据业务名称、定义、描述和别名来表示数据仓库和业务系统中的各种属性,直接供业务分析人员使用 业务元数据使经营分析系统使用人员能够更好理解、使用数据仓库,成为经营分析系统使用人员在数据仓库中的业务向
2、导,经营分析系统关心的元数据,技术元数据包含关于经营分析系统数据技术层面的信息数据源元数据ETL元数据数据仓库元数据数据集市元数据OLAP SERVER元数据前端展现元数据其它类型元数据(挖掘模型,数据质量分析结果等),经营分析系统关心的元数据,管理元数据主要是指经营分析日常建设过程中,涉及开发、运维等管理流程的基本信息。,提纲,元数据管理基本概念元数据定义元数据管理CWM元数据标准CWM标准概述对象模型层基础层资源层分析层管理层,元数据管理,管理商业智能系统的元数据贯穿商业智能系统的各个环节系统的各个处理单元由元数据驱动,管理元数据的意义,有哪些数据?它们在哪里用?它的业务定义是什么?这个数
3、据还叫什么?它与其他数据有什么关系?谁用这个数据?为什么我们要用它?最近修改是什么时候?这些数据准确、可靠吗?,管理元数据的意义,理解企业内部的信息资源动态的数据字典数据的浏览和归纳数据在企业内部横向与纵向传递保持整个企业的标准(保证企业内部统一的商业定义和商业规则)数据生命周期的管理,元数据管理的几个概念,元模型(meta model)元数据库(metadata repository)元数据管理工具,元模型,关于元数据的“元数据”MDIS(Meta Data Interchange Specification)元数据联盟发布的元数据交换规范OIM(Open Information Model
4、)CA和微软的元数据标准OIM组织已经解散CWM(Common Warehouse Metamodel)OMG组织制定的标准得到IBM,NCR,SAS,Hyperion等公司支持利用XMI文件进行交换,元数据库,元数据库就是一个逻辑上的统一存储元数据的地点元数据存储常见的形式分散存储统一存储,提供不同接口统一存储,统一接口,不同系统各自提供元数据接口,实现复杂元数据不统一易成为”蜘蛛网”,中央元数据存储,所有存取必须通过中央存储元数据交换不方便中央元数据存储必须对每一个系统有转换接口,基于标准的中央元数据管理,有利于元数据的交换屏蔽系统内部变化中央元数据只需要统一接口,元数据管理工具,元数据浏
5、览、展示和管理的平台知名的元数据管理工具包括:Meta CenterMeta MatrixMeta IntegrationDB2,Teradata,Oracle等数据仓库中的元数据管理模块,提纲,元数据管理基本概念元数据定义元数据管理CWM元数据标准CWM标准概述对象模型层基础层资源层分析层管理层,CWM标准背景,OMG是一个拥有500多会员的国际标准化组织,著名的CORBA标准即出自该组织。公共仓库元模型(Common Warehouse Metamodel)的主要目的是在异构环境下,帮助不同的数据仓库工具、平台和元数据知识库进行元数据交换。,CWM标准的意义,在形成标准以前,要进行集成的情
6、况如下图所示:,CWM标准的意义,在形成标准以后的情况如下图所示:,CWM的发展状况,成为OMG提出的基于模型驱动的体系结构(MDA)的核心之一(其它是MOF和UML),CWM标准概述,CWM标准是基于以下工业标准制定的:UML:它对CWM模型进行建模。MOF(元对象设施):为CWM提供元模型的体系结构和元模型语言的语义;MOF反射接口为存取CWM元数据提供通用的API接口;MOF到IDL的映射为存储CWM元数据提供了一种产生CWM IDL 接口的机制。XMI(XML元数据交换):它可以使元数据以XML文件流的方式进行交换。CORBA IDL(CORBA 接口定义语言),OMG元数据体系结构,
7、OMG元数据体系结构实例,PRODUCT表和它的记录,M0层,OMG元数据体系结构实例,M1层,Product表元数据,OMG元数据体系结构实例,M2层,简单关系型表元模型,CWM元数据存储和接口实现,CWM的发展状况,绝大多数数据仓库和元数据管理工具已经支持CWM,或已经宣布在下一版本的产品中支持CWM。已经被JAVA标准化组织着手扩展到J2EE体系结构当中,形成JMI(JAVA Metadata Interchange)规范、用于OLAP分析的JOLAP规范和用于数据挖掘的JDMAPI规范。,CWM的合作伙伴,IBMUnisysNCRHyperionOracleUBSGenesisDime
8、nsion EDI,CWM的支持者,DeereSUNHPData AccessInlineAonixHitachiSASMeta IntegrationAdaptive,ETL产品,OLAP产品,数据仓库元数据管理产品,提纲,元数据管理基本概念元数据定义元数据管理CWM元数据标准CWM标准概述对象模型层基础层资源层分析层管理层,CWM标准包及其分层,对象模型层(Object Model),CWM对象模型提供了描述其他所有包中元数据模型的类的基本结构和相应的类型属性定义基本元模型的概念,关系和约束包括4个基本包:核心包(Core)行为包(Behavioral)关系包(Relationship)实
9、例包(Instance),核心包(Core),包含所有的其他CWM包使用的基本类和关联不依赖于其他任何包,行为包(Behavioral),描述其他CWM包中类的行为特征,提供一个记录特定行为请求的基础 包括操作,方法,接口,事件等,关系包(Relationship),描述CWM对象之间如何互相联系定义了两种类型的关系泛化(Generalization)关联(Association)泛化是具有普遍性的对象和特定对象的关联,层次化的结构关联定义两个或多个类元之间的特定关系,实例包(Instance),提供了在CWM交换中包含带值元数据的基础结构,提纲,元数据管理基本概念元数据定义元数据管理CWM元
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 数据管理 CWM 标准 解析 课件
链接地址:https://www.31ppt.com/p-3876693.html